Dope Live Session with actor, director, and writer Michael Bow, who stars in the hit CW series “Kung Fu,” where he plays K-pop star warrior, Simon Lau. Due to the overwhelming love of the fans/viewers, Michael’s character was brought back to life with a surprise return to the new season (after previously “dying,” in the last). The series makes history as the CW’s first all-Asian cast, and can additionally be found streaming on HBO Max.
Michael’s previous credits include “Hacks,” (HBO Max) “The Maze Runner,” “How To Get Away With Murder,” (ABC), “Grey’s Anatomy,” (ABC), to give the short list. He also portrayed one of the first Asian Male love interests in the teen drama “TURNT.”
Great conversation covering the defining moment that made Mike choose entertainment as a career, the historic significance of the series having an all-Asian cast, and of course we had fun talking about the original series. One of the key answers to why he does what he does is that Bow aspires to use his voice and platform to push past the barriers of Asian stereotypes.
